    The main symptoms of adnexitis include lower abdominal pain, fever, abnormal vaginal discharge, irregular menstruation and discomfort with urination. Adnexitis is usually caused by factors such as pathogen infection, spread of inflammation in adjacent organs, uterine cavity operation infection, low immunity or sexually transmitted diseases, and requires timely medical treatment for a clear diagnosis.

    1. Lower abdominal pain

    Patients with adnexitis often present with persistent dull pain or bloating in the lower abdomen, which worsens after activity or sexual intercourse. The pain may radiate to the lumbosacral region or inner thigh, and may be accompanied by peritoneal irritation in severe cases. This symptom is related to pelvic congestion and inflammatory exudate irritating nerves.     2. Fever

    Acute adnexitis often presents with fever above 38°C, which may be accompanied by systemic symptoms such as chills and headache. Fever is caused by pathogenic toxins entering the blood and triggering an inflammatory reaction. Routine blood tests showed elevated white blood cells and neutrophils.     3. Abnormal vaginal discharge

    Increased purulent or purulent leucorrhea is a typical symptom and may have a peculiar smell. Examination of cervical secretions can detect pathogens such as gonococcus and chlamydia.     4. Irregular menstruation

    Inflammation affecting ovarian function may lead to menstrual cycle disorders, increased menstrual flow, or worsening dysmenorrhea. Those who do not heal for a long time may develop secondary infertility.     5. Discomfort in urination

    Some patients experience bladder irritation symptoms such as frequent urination, urgency, and tingling during urination, which are caused by inflammation involving the urinary system. Routine urine examination showed leukocyturia.
